World-known company Ibanez introduced their new collection in spring 2008 and that one differs from any other a lot.

Most of renowned guitars as Epiphone guitars, Gibson, Fender and others have some traditions and even new instruments commonly get the design that looks like all their classic models, but Ibanez rejected to perform the same. Surely, that is the sound which prior of all matters in a musical instrument, but when the instrument is also a pleasant for the eyes, contentment doubles.

Ibanez Spring 2008 Special Limited Edition series says that Ibanez is genuine Japanese trademark. Such new models as RG and SRX comprise brilliant brand's sound standards and advanced appearance. Such parts as “Japan black” finish and red fastening make these guitars look really Japanese. The tender sakura carving prompts a subtle note of something intangible which you can't clutch but can definitely feel.

The first thought that is generated in your head when you see modern RGR is “That is made in Japan”. This ninja “weapon”, made for an assassination on stage, is abstinently plain in its appearance but dangerously strong in its sound. The instrument is clothed in black, with no adornment but a white body and neck fastening. Having looked at it you can't find any unnecessary part. That guitar is worthy of being the most popular if we speak about the Ibanez spring collection. There is an unrivalled model in spring 2008 collection named Pat Metheny's PM-35. This wonderful guitar player has been with Ibanez for more than 20 years. The thought was to make the high class electric guitars available for younger players and it has been performed in that model with the highest quality traditions and an intermediate cost level. Pat Metheny noticed that he is very glad that Ibanez brand made this instrument available for anyone who desires it.
